Telepsychiatry is also able to bring mental health services into areas that aren't served. According to the Agency for Healthcare Research and Quality (AHRQ), one of every eight emergency department visits is due to a mental health problem. Unfortunately, the majority of emergency departments do not have a psychiatrist on staff to support these patients. Telepsychiatry can help solve this issue by connecting patients via teleconference to psychiatrists.
Unlike therapists, psychiatrists have a medical degree and can prescribe medication. Some telehealth platforms don't allow psychiatrists to prescribe specific types of medication, like stimulants and controlled substances. However, a number of telehealth platforms are trying to address this issue by expanding their psychiatrists' networks that can provide these services.

Online Psychiatry - How it works
When you make an appointment through Talkspace and you'll be able to talk to a licensed psychiatrist or psychiatric nurse practitioner via video chat. In the initial meeting they'll ask standard questions about your symptoms and medical history. They'll also talk about your current medications and how you're experiencing them. They will then recommend the treatment plan that includes prescription medications (unless it's controlled substances, which aren't legal to prescribe over the internet).
Once your consultation is complete After your consultation is completed, your doctor will send you a prescription by email or text. You can pick up your medication at your local pharmacy, or get it delivered to your house. If you have health insurance, the company will submit your claim on your behalf. If you're paying out of pocket, you can make use of your credit card, PayPal account, or a health savings or flexible spending account.
